Systems Integrator
Enabling CGI to manage Kubernetes securely across multiple clouds
Deployment time reduced from 1 week to 1 hour
The Challenge
Multi-cloud Kubernetes beyond AWS
CGI's machine learning platform, Lovelace, was developed exclusively on AWS EKS using CloudFormation templates. While this worked well for AWS deployments, it could not provision to other cloud-managed Kubernetes clusters such as Azure AKS or GCP GKE, limiting the options available to CGI's customers.
Cloud provider-specific tools couldn't transfer between AWS, Azure, and GCP, and native tooling lacked scalability beyond AWS. Outdated Kubernetes versions risked exposure to security vulnerabilities, while manual configuration for TLS, DNS, and open-source tooling required constant monitoring and evaluation.
- × Lovelace platform built exclusively on AWS EKS using CloudFormation templates
- × Could not provision to Azure AKS or GCP GKE, limiting customer options
- × Cloud provider-specific tools couldn't transfer between AWS, Azure, and GCP
- × Native tooling lacked scalability beyond AWS
- × Outdated Kubernetes versions risked exposure to security vulnerabilities and attacks
- × Manual configuration for TLS, DNS, and open-source tooling required constant monitoring and evaluation
Our Approach
Wayfinder-powered multi-cloud Kubernetes management
Appvia deployed Wayfinder to replace cloud-specific tooling with a single management layer across all three cloud providers, automating provisioning, security hardening, and platform component configuration.
Automated Cluster Provisioning Management
Abstracted cloud provider-specific options, enabled self-served clusters and namespaces with automated best practices, and supported on-demand auto-scaling.
Automated Policy Administration & Security Hardening
Highest security standards across clusters, least-privilege and time-based access, CIS benchmark compliance without human error, pod security restrictions and network policies.
Automated Configuration of Platform Components
ExternalDNS, Cert-Manager, and Nginx ingress controller provisioned automatically with zero operational overhead.
Consolidated Management Interface
Simplified creation and maintenance of secure Kubernetes clusters across GKE, AKS, and EKS from a single interface.
The Outcome
Measurable impact across all clouds
Wayfinder eliminated the complexity of managing Kubernetes across multiple clouds. CGI's teams can now focus on building applications rather than fighting infrastructure.
Deployment time slashed
Deployment time reduced from 1 week to 1 hour through automated provisioning and configuration.
Secure multi-cloud Kubernetes
Secure Kubernetes management across AWS, Azure, and GCP from a single platform.
Developer focus maintained
Teams maintained focus on application development instead of infrastructure management.
Automated maintenance
Automated patches, updates, and upgrades for Kubernetes, OS, and networking.
Deployment at scale
Application deployment at scale with GitOps integration across all cloud providers.
Security best-practice adherence
All clusters managed with security best-practice adherence, including CIS benchmarks and least-privilege access.
Key Metric
1 week → 1 hour
Deployment time reduction
More Case Studies
See how other organisations succeeded
TEG
Developer self-service in 5 weeks
AWS landing zones and Wayfinder delivered developer self-service for 50 engineers in 5 weeks.
Nominet
Environment creation from 2 weeks to 1 hour
Comprehensive AWS landing zone programme with FinOps, reducing environment creation to 1 hour.
Acorn Insurance
Self-service platform transforms developer experience
Internal developer platform on Azure enabling self-service infrastructure in under 24 hours.
Ready to get started?
Whether you need a cloud assessment, a platform accelerator, or a fully managed service - let's start with a conversation.